понедельник, 7 мая 2012 г.

Inforbix, или как понять данные?

Мне всегда была интересна тема массивов данных: будь то текст, картинки, чертежи, модели. Раньше я мечтал об освоении (P)DM-системы для работы. Потом это увлечение как-то прошло, и я перешел к осмыслению стандартных возможностей Windows. С помощью Inforbix я продолжаю разбираться, что информацию можно получить из данных о файле или метаданных.
По сути, в Inforbix два основных инструмента: поиск и отчеты. Отчеты можно визуализировать через диаграммы. Все понятно с поиском. Ищешь либо то, что знаешь конкретно (например, имя файла), либо ищешь в определенной области (например, все компоненты SketchUp), постепенно сужая поиск и "просеивая" результаты. Или находишь искомое, или ничего не находишь.


С отчетами веселее. Отчет - это структурированные данные по какому-либо признаку. Структурировать данные можно и добавляя/убирая столбцы атрибутов, и фильтруя сами результаты, и сортируя по значению. Остается понять, что эти отчеты значат. Если хорошо представляешь цель и "фильтры" - все хорошо, а если нет...

Ниже приведу пример "удачного" отчета (как мне кажется), где структурированные данные начинают "говорить".

Итак, все pdf-альбомы по проекту с шифром "062":
Столбцы: ID, Автор, Размер Файла, Последнее изменение, Кол-во страниц. Если бы альбом создавали разные люди, аккуратно заполнявшие поле в Google LayOut, то можно было бы оценить кто и сколько выпустил альбомов. Интересно проследить, как во времени меняется размер файла, количество страниц в нем. Из этой таблицы я могу сделать некоторые выводы о том, как продвигался проект.

Пример был бы еще нагляднее, если бы количество строк в таблице было больше. Допустим, 20. Тогда эти данные недостаточно структурировать, становится крайне необходима их визуализация. Ниже я привожу график, на котором видно, как во времени изменялся размер файла (высота столбика).
Как мы видим, в определенный момент времени произошел резкий скачок размера файла. Представим, что таких проектов у нас идет одновременно штук 5 - ценность такой визуализаци возрастет.

Однако, Inforbix - это не совсем инструмент управления проектом, где людские процессы находят свою формализацию. Эти людские процессы мы обнаруживаем опосредованно, не напрямую: через атрибуты Author, Last Modified etc. Поэтому применить и затем сделать понятным нужный паттерн для отчета в массе разнородных данных - непростое умение, которому надо еще учиться.

Мне кажется, несмотря на то, что стандартные (P)DM предоставляют больше понятного функционала для проектировщика, метод Infrobix может дать больше возможностей для анализа данных и процессов засчет своей гибкости, хотя это требует более глубокого понимания и механизмов файловой системы, и особенностей деятельности проектировщика. Как-то так.

2 комментария:

  1. Evgeny, thanks for sharing your thoughts... You point of something very valuable - how to make reports even simpler to a potential user. Actually, we started to do so on Infobrix App home page. We do have something we called - useful tasks. It seems to me, we can try to transform your ideas to more predefined reports. I'd be glad to discuss additional options that can be valuable. Today we have two options for reports - report by Category; report by a person. Try it, please and tell us if you think we can add more templates there. Thanks, Oleg

    ОтветитьУдалить
  2. Thank you, Oleg, for such a feedback. We discussed this topic with Lev, and I hope that conversation was useful for him. I see that Inforbix provides quite enough for the report templates. However, new report patterns could be explored when more people (than myself only)are involved in the design process.

    ОтветитьУдалить